If you simply send a price quote to a client and they never actually accept or confirm it, it wont be considered legally binding. On the other hand, if you provide a written quote to a client detailing a job and they provide an electronic signature to confirm their acceptance, a formal agreement has been established.
What is a Quote? In construction, a quote is a document that has a detailed breakdown of the expected costs that are associated with a proposed project. This includes facets like labor cost, material costs, and quantities. Usually, quotes are only going to be valid for a certain period of timegenerally about a month. Is a Quote a Legally Binding Contract? No, a quote by itself is not a binding contract. It is a document that outlines your terms of service and how much you would charge were those terms accepted. In a court of law, only bargains that are agreed upon by both parties are considered legally binding quotations.
